Linux下快速搭建MySQL数据库应用

Linux下快速搭建MySQL数据库应用

MySQL是一种常见的开源关系型数据库管理系统,在Linux系统中可以快速搭建并应用于各种应用程序中。本文将介绍如何在Linux下快速搭建MySQL数据库应用。

步骤一:安装MySQL

首先,我们需要安装MySQL数据库软件。在Linux系统中,可以使用包管理工具来安装MySQL。以下是在常用Linux发行版中安装MySQL的命令:

sudo apt-get update

sudo apt-get install mysql-server

在安装过程中,系统会提示您设置MySQL的root用户密码。请确保密码设置安全并牢记。

步骤二:启动MySQL

安装完成后,我们需要启动MySQL服务。通过以下命令启动MySQL服务:

sudo systemctl start mysql

您还可以使用以下命令检查MySQL的运行状态:

sudo systemctl status mysql

如果成功启动,您将看到一条类似于“Active: active (running)”的消息。

步骤三:进入MySQL命令行

启动MySQL服务后,您可以通过以下命令进入MySQL的命令行:

mysql -u root -p

系统会要求您输入MySQL的root用户密码。在输入密码后,您将进入MySQL的命令行界面。

步骤四:创建数据库

在MySQL的命令行中,我们可以使用以下命令创建一个数据库:

CREATE DATABASE mydatabase;

请将“mydatabase”替换为您希望创建的数据库名称。

步骤五:创建数据库用户

在MySQL中,我们可以为每个数据库创建一个或多个用户,并为这些用户分配不同的权限。以下是创建一个新用户并为其分配权限的命令示例:

CREATE USER 'myuser'@'localhost' IDENTIFIED BY 'mypassword';

GRANT ALL PRIVILEGES ON mydatabase.* TO 'myuser'@'localhost';

请将“myuser”和“mypassword”分别替换为您希望的用户名和密码,同时将“mydatabase”替换为您创建的数据库名称。

步骤六:退出MySQL命令行

当您完成数据库的创建和用户权限的设置后,您可以通过以下命令退出MySQL的命令行:

QUIT;

您将返回到Linux的命令行界面。

步骤七:连接数据库

在应用程序中连接MySQL数据库时,您需要提供数据库的连接信息。以下是一个示例的PHP代码,用于连接MySQL数据库:

<?php

$servername = "localhost";

$username = "myuser";

$password = "mypassword";

$dbname = "mydatabase";

// 创建连接

$conn = new mysqli($servername, $username, $password, $dbname);

// 检查连接是否成功

if ($conn->connect_error) {

die("连接失败: " . $conn->connect_error);

}

echo "连接成功";

?>

请将“localhost”替换为您的MySQL服务器地址,“myuser”和“mypassword”替换为您创建的用户名和密码,“mydatabase”替换为您创建的数据库名称。如果连接成功,将输出“连接成功”的消息。

总结

通过以上步骤,您可以在Linux系统中快速搭建MySQL数据库应用。首先安装MySQL软件,然后启动MySQL服务。接着通过命令行进入MySQL并创建数据库和用户权限。最后,在应用程序中使用适当的连接信息连接MySQL数据库。这样,您就可以开始在Linux系统下开发和应用MySQL数据库应用了。

操作系统标签